Differences in Certification Requirements
When considering an accounting certification, the requirements can vary significantly. For example, the Certified Public Accountant (CPA) certification requires a bachelor’s degree in accounting and several years of work experience, as well as passing a rigorous exam. In contrast, the QuickBooks certification requires completing a series of courses or exams, which can be completed online. This makes QuickBooks certification a more accessible option for those who may not have a background in accounting or who are just starting their career.

Comparison to Other Accounting Certifications
Other accounting certifications, such as the Certified Management Accountant (CMA) and the Certified Internal Auditor (CIA), require a different set of skills and knowledge. For example, the CMA requires a bachelor’s degree in accounting or a related field and several years of work experience, as well as passing a comprehensive exam. The CIA, on the other hand, requires a bachelor’s degree and passing a series of exams that cover internal auditing and risk management.
